New truck racing team from Berlin

New truck racing team from Berlin

09. February 2018It’s been known for quite a while now that Berlin businessman Sven Walter plans to field a team of his own in the FIA European Truck Racing Championship. Before an announcement could be made, however, a number of loose ends remained to be tied up. Walter quickly came to an agreement with Jochen Hahn (you couldn’t miss the Sven Walter Logistik banner script emblazoned across the front of the vice-champ’s Iveco race truck last season) to have Hahn – the most formidable race truck constructor of this decade – build his track machine, and Walter’s “Don’t Touch Racing” team will be good to go in time for the season-opener at the Misano World Circuit at end-May. It will be an all-new outfit, yes, but the crew are no greenhorns. Walter himself boasts an all-in, hands-on engagement with the sport that few other sponsors can, having wasted no opportunity to get his hands dirty as a mechanic over the last few years. The handpicked members of his service crew are no truck race novices either, and the Iveco will be piloted by tankpool24 Racing regular André Kursim.
